“Pinwheels
for Peace!”
International Day of Peace
Wednesday, September 21
Euclid High School Students are Standing Up for “Whirled” Peace by participating in an International Peace Day Project called “Pinwheels for Peace”. Students in all Art Classes, Mediation, Stand Up! Committee, SAVE Club and more are making colorful pinwheels that contain messages of peace. The pinwheels will be “planted” on the front lawn of Euclid High School on Wednesday, September 21 between 3 and 9 pm as a symbol for peace in our community and throughout the world.
The pinwheels will then be taken to Shore Cultural Center on Friday, September 23rd to be displayed during their Art and Farmer’s Market. Pinwheels will be for sale here to benefit the Euclid High School Mediators so they may attend “Peace Jam” where they meet Nobel Peace Prize winners and learn how to become peaceful leaders within our school and in our community. Mediators will even help you make your own pinwheel between the hours of 4 and 7 pm. There will be a free concert for your enjoyment given by the Passport Project, a group featuring African dancers and drummers. Please join us!
